In silver gilt with red, white, blue and green enamels, number impressed "C476" on the reverse, measuring 52. 2 mm (w) x 55. 5 mm (h) inclusive of its integral ring, on a shortened neck ribbon, intact enamels, scattered gilt wear, near extremely fine.
